Decor Tips to Turn Your Home into a Coastal Paradise
Dreaming about how you would decorate your new beachfront property? Or maybe you want to work on livening your space up with some fresh beachy vibes. Whether you are currently on the hunt for your dream home or still dreaming about it, take a look at these ideas for an ocean-inspired space. Whether you make simple changes or go all in, the coastal design aesthetic can bring lots of light, greenery, and color to your home.

Light and Bright
Bring on the sunshine! No matter what type of sun exposure your home has, aim to let as much light in as possible to create a brilliant, airy space. Opt for sheer curtains for the windows in the bedrooms and porch areas. This will allow for some privacy while still letting the light pour in!

Greenery is Key
Beach homes are all about blending the indoor and outdoor living areas. Make sure to add some greenery to establish that continuum and boost the mood of the space overall. Palm fronds, banana leaves, and orchids are all great options to capture that soothing island vibe.

A Splash of Bold
When you think of a tropical paradise, the signature turquoise, coral, and palm green colors come to mind. You can pick a statement area (like the front door) to add a splash of bold color to the area. Or you can choose a color or two to use as accent pieces around the entire home!

Play with Patterns
You can also get creative and try out different patterns. The best way to go about this is to keep the patterns in the same color family. The most popular color for a nautical themed home is blue. Add in a variety of patterns - from floral to geometric and everything in between!

Color Pairing
Attempt to bring the natural sea, sky and grassy hues into your living space. Opt for blues and greens to pair with each other for a calming and optimistic atmosphere. Try starting with a pattern incorporating the two colors and then extend to solids elsewhere, such as furniture or an accent wall.

Throw in Natural Fibers
Seeing a theme here? Au natural is the way to go when creating your seaside retreat. Try adding some natural woven fibers into your space. Materials from plant fibers like jute, hemp, bamboo, sisal, or wood help to bring a relaxed feeling to your home. Natural fiber rugs are very durable and versatile to spruce up almost any area.
